My iPad Review

1.5 pound, half inch thin touch-screen computer with everywhere connectivity.

Why I Picked It Up: 50% gadget lust, 45% hope that I could lighten my load when on the road, and 5% not wanting to be left behind when the revolution came.

Why I’m Keeping It:

  • Now I leave my MacBook at home unless I need to draw or code.
  • Also left at home: books. DRM’d eBooks suck, but I like reading on this thing a lot.
  • Actively prefer it for web surfing, email, Twitter, video, maps, and Words With Friends.
  • I enjoy holding the future in my hands.

I’d give it to: My dad, who needs a computer he can’t mess up by downloading malware.
